Bunk Beds and Lofts

Bunk beds and lofts have been a staple of bedrooms for kids for decades. With a variety of configurations and double-duty furniture, they can add style and utility to any kid's room.

The typical bunk bed is two twin-sized mattresses stacked on top of each other. Some models are arranged as a full-over futon bunk, where the lower mattress can be turned into a sofa.

What is a Midi-Bunk Bed?

A midi bunk is a clever way to maximize space in your child's bedroom. They're not as high as standard bunk beds, but they offer plenty of storage space in the shape of desks and chests of drawers that can be tucked away under the bed frame when it is not in use. They're ideal for kids who don't want to be too high up in beds, or for kids who want a lot of study space that tucks away neatly when not being used. The Midi Bunk Bed and the Trundle Bed The Trundle bed

A trundle is an efficient solution for space saving that can be put under a bunk bed or a high sleeper. It lets you have a spare bed to guests. It's a big drawer that can be pulled out, and is placed on the floor, and is usually on castors that permit smooth glide on carpets.

They are great for children because they provide a sleeping area that is separated from the rest of the room. This gives them some privacy and security as opposed to traditional bunk beds which can be noisy. They're also a great alternative for children who have difficulty climbing to or from the top of the bunk.

Trundles are prone to wear down faster mid sleeper bed than a mattress because of the frequency it's used. That's why it tends to be a better choice for rooms for guests that don't see frequent use, or for short-term use for siblings staying over for the weekend.

Some trundle beds are suitable for twin-sized mattresses, while others are able to accommodate full or queen-sized mattresses too. You'll also need to consider the amount of storage space you would like in a trundle mattress, and whether you'd prefer it to have a flat base or a pop-up design.
